Claim this profile

Nacho's Tire Shop

5.0

EZlocal Rating Star

Total Reviews: 1

55 W 16th St

Merced, CA 95340-4933

(209) 725-1268

Business Map

Map Details

Area: Merced, CA 95340

Coordinates: 37.29829, -120.477152

KML: KML

Back to Nacho's Tire Shop Profile

Google Reviews
Facebook Ads
EZlocal 17 Years
BBB A+
Bing Ads